Zapier

Zapier AI

Zapier AI combines natural-language assistance with workflow automation across Zapier's application connector network.

Who is Zapier AI best for?

Zapier AI is strongest for operations teams automating repetitive hand-offs, small businesses connecting saas tools, builders who prefer low-code automation. Fit still depends on the real workflow, controls and budget.

How is Zapier AI priced?

Free automation tier with paid usage-based plans. CryptoXAI links to the official pricing source because plan limits and terms can change.
